Possible Signatures of New Physics in e+e- and pp Collisions

Abstract:
A preon model with preonic charge predicts many unique new particles.
Among them, several are expected to be relatively light, including the fermion lS, which is a stable WIMP, bosons U0 and U+ and the lepto-quark fermion q'.
The production of these particles in e+e- and pp collisions is discussed, focusing on e+e-→UlS(e) and pp→q'q'+ X.
A signature of the latter is dilepton + 2 charm jets + missing energy.
A discussion on reported unusual events in the dilepton + jets sample is made based on q'q' production.
